Type what you are searching for:

Что такое SQL и как с ним взаимодействовать

Что такое SQL и как с ним взаимодействовать

Что такое SQL и как с ним взаимодействовать

SQL представляет собой средство упорядоченных запросов для управления сведениями в реляционных базах данных. Язык позволяет генерировать таблицы, включать записи, корректировать информацию и удалять лишнюю информацию. SQL используют программисты, аналитики, управляющие баз данных и тестировщики.

Язык работает через команды, которые направляются системе управления базами данных. Команды оформляются текстом по установленным нормам синтаксиса. Система получает команду, обрабатывает команду и выдаёт итог.

Взаимодействие с SQL открывается с изучения ключевых инструкций для выборки и изменения данных. Начинающие изучают команды SELECT, INSERT, UPDATE и DELETE. Опыт деятельности с admiral x помогает закрепить навыки и постичь принцип создания команд.

SQL выделяется декларативным методом к программированию. Пользователь указывает необходимый итог, а система автономно определяет способ выполнения действия. Подобный способ облегчает формирование команд для неопытных профессионалов.

Для чего требуется SQL

SQL задействуется для содержания и обработки упорядоченной данных в бизнес и некоммерческих разработках. Инструмент обеспечивает скоростной подключение к миллионам записей и обеспечивает возможность производить аналитические процедуры над данными.

Интернет-магазины эксплуатируют SQL для контроля каталогами продуктов, обработки заказов и фиксации запасов. Финансовые системы содержат данные о клиентах, переводах и балансах в реляционных базах. Социальные сети применяют инструмент для деятельности с профилями участников и публикациями.

Аналитики admiral x casino получают сведения из баз для создания документов и обнаружения закономерностей. SQL даёт возможность суммировать показатели, вычислять средние величины и объединять сведения по условиям. Маркетологи изучают действия потребителей с помощью запросов к базам данных.

Девелоперы формируют программы, которые взаимодействуют с базами через SQL. Интернет-сервисы направляют команды для извлечения информации и вывода содержимого. Портативные программы синхронизируют информацию с серверами.

Как организованы базы данных и таблицы

База данных является собой структурированное репозиторий сведений, включающее из связанных таблиц. Каждая таблица включает информацию об конкретной элементе: клиентах, товарах, заказах или транзакциях. Структура базы создаётся с принятием во внимание коммерческих требований и особенностей тематической отрасли.

Таблица состоит из строк и столбцов, имитируя электронную таблицу. Столбцы описывают свойства сущностей и именуются полями. Строки содержат конкретные записи с информацией об индивидуальных экземплярах элемента. Каждое поле имеет конкретный вид данных: цифровой, текстовый, дата или булевый.

Первичный ключ однозначно распознаёт каждую элемент в таблице. Зачастую основным ключом становится числовое поле с неповторимыми параметрами. Вторичные ключи устанавливают связи между таблицами и обеспечивают непротиворечивость данных в базе.

Основные части организации таблицы охватывают:

  • Название таблицы, отражающее хранимую элемент
  • Набор полей с указанием форматов данных
  • Правила для контроля достоверности вводимой сведений
  • Индексы для ускорения обнаружения записей

Нормализация базы данных убирает дублирование сведений и разделяет сведения по профильным таблицам. Механизм нормализации соответствует заданным нормам, обозначаемым каноническими формами. Верная организация адмирал х делает проще поддержку и улучшает эффективность системы.

Диаграмма базы данных наглядно показывает таблицы и отношения между ними. Графики способствуют осознать принцип построения информации и спроектировать эффективную организацию. Взаимодействие с admiral x требует знания основ создания реляционных моделей данных.

Базовые операторы для деятельности с данными

SELECT извлекает данные из таблиц базы данных. Команда обеспечивает возможность определить требуемые поля и условия фильтрации записей. Оператор отдаёт ответ в формате множества элементов, отвечающих параметрам запроса.

INSERT добавляет свежие строки в таблицу. Инструкция нуждается указания наименования таблицы и значений для заполнения полей. Можно добавить одну строку или ряд записей за одну команду. Система анализирует соответствие данных видам полей перед добавлением.

UPDATE изменяет присутствующие строки в таблице. Оператор позволяет скорректировать величины единственного или ряда полей. Параметр WHERE указывает, какие элементы нуждаются изменению. Без обозначения параметра команда обновит все записи в таблице.

DELETE удаляет элементы из таблицы по определённому условию. Инструкция навсегда стирает информацию, поэтому нуждается внимательного употребления. Критерий WHERE указывает, какие элементы необходимо устранить.

CREATE TABLE создаёт свежую таблицу с определённой архитектурой полей. Оператор указывает наименования колонок, типы данных и ограничения. DROP TABLE целиком устраняет таблицу вместе со всем содержимым. Освоение admiral-x формирует базовые умения контроля данными в реляционных механизмах хранения.

Отбор, упорядочивание и классификация строк

Критерий WHERE отбирает записи по определённым условиям. Инструкция обеспечивает возможность извлечь строки, соответствующие установленным параметрам полей. Можно эксплуатировать инструкции сопоставления и булевы действия AND, OR, NOT для создания составных критериев. Выборка уменьшает объём выдаваемых сведений.

ORDER BY упорядочивает итоги отбора по единственному или ряду колонкам. Инструкция поддерживает сортировку по росту и убыванию параметров. Упорядочивание записей упрощает анализ сведений и нахождение требуемых параметров.

GROUP BY объединяет элементы с идентичными значениями в определённых столбцах. Группировка задействуется параллельно с агрегирующими функциями для расчёта итоговых величин. Операции COUNT, SUM, AVG, MIN и MAX определяют число строк, суммы, средние параметры, минимумы и максимальные значения.

HAVING фильтрует результаты после группировки данных. Параметр задействуется к суммированным величинам и позволяет выбрать совокупности, удовлетворяющие конкретным условиям по вычисленным величинам.

Команды LIKE и IN увеличивают способности фильтрации данных. LIKE выполняет обнаружение по шаблону с подстановочными знаками. IN анализирует присутствие параметра в перечень опций. Корректное применение адмирал х увеличивает производительность исследовательских инструкций.

Как связываются данные из разных таблиц

JOIN соединяет записи из множества таблиц на основании связей между ними. Действие позволяет извлечь информацию, распределённую по различным таблицам, в единственном итоговом множестве. Соединение устанавливается через общие поля, как правило первичный и внешний ключи.

INNER JOIN возвращает лишь те записи, для которых обнаружены соответствия в обеих таблицах. Элементы без соответствия отбрасываются из итога. Этот вид связывания применяется, когда требуются информация, имеющиеся синхронно в взаимосвязанных таблицах.

LEFT JOIN охватывает все записи из левой таблицы и соответствующие записи из правой. Если пересечение отсутствует, поля правой таблицы наполняются величинами NULL. Команда применяется для получения целого списка элементов из главной таблицы.

RIGHT JOIN работает обратным методом, оставляя все записи правой таблицы. FULL OUTER JOIN выдаёт все строки из двух таблиц, заполняя недостающие величины NULL.

CROSS JOIN создаёт декартово комбинацию таблиц, соединяя каждую элемент первой таблицы с каждой элементом второй. Субзапросы позволяют применять ответ единственного запроса внутри другого. Изучение admiral x и понимание способов объединения таблиц расширяет способности взаимодействия с admiral-x в многотабличных базах данных.

Распространённые вопросы, которые выполняют с помощью SQL

Генерация сводок составляет немалую долю деятельности с базами данных. Аналитики получают информацию о сделках, заказчиках и финансовых показателях за конкретные интервалы. Инструкции консолидируют сведения и группируют результаты по группам для представления руководству.

Поиск копий содействует обеспечивать качество информации в системе. Запросы обнаруживают повторяющиеся записи по главным колонкам: email, телефон или уникальный номер. Нахождение повторов даёт возможность привести в порядок базу и исключить сбои.

Перенос сведений между структурами нуждается выгрузки информации из единственной базы и импорта в иную. SQL обеспечивает экспорт записей в требуемом формате и импорт сведений с изменением структуры.

Вычисление статистических показателей производится через суммирующие операции и консолидацию данных. Специалисты рассчитывают усреднённый платёж потребителя, конверсию воронки продаж и изменение роста клиентской базы.

Администрирование правами доступа лимитирует возможности пользователей по взаимодействия с информацией. Управляющие назначают разрешения на чтение, изменение и стирание данных для различных функций. Практическое задействование адмирал х охватывает обширный набор вопросов от исследования до управления структур.

Промахи, которых следует обходить в старте деятельности

Отсутствие условия WHERE при модификации или удалении элементов приводит к изменению всех записей в таблице. Начинающие пропускают указать условие фильтрации и ошибочно изменяют информацию, которые призваны остаться неизменёнными. Перед запуском инструкций UPDATE и DELETE нужно проверить параметр отбора.

Игнорирование индексов снижает скорость выполнение команд к объёмным таблицам. Обнаружение без индексов принуждает систему анализировать все элементы поочерёдно. Формирование индексов для регулярно применяемых полей ускоряет действия извлечения сведений в десятки раз.

Стандартные неточности новичков профессионалов включают:

  • Задействование SELECT * вместо указания нужных столбцов, что усиливает нагрузку на систему
  • Отсутствие запасного дублирования перед крупными корректировками сведений
  • Сохранение паролей и закрытой сведений в явном формате
  • Пренебрежение ограничений согласованности при создании таблиц

Ошибочное использование видов данных влечёт к избыточному потреблению дискового объёма. Выбор строкового поля большого объёма для сохранения небольших параметров нерационален. Каждый вид данных содержит наилучшую сферу применения и условия.

Игнорирование транзакциями при выполнении связанных операций нарушает целостность информации. Если единственная из операторов заканчивается неточностью, предыдущие модификации сохраняются в базе. Транзакции предоставляют атомарность реализации совокупности операций.

Дублирование инструкций без понимания принципа деятельности порождает сложности при изменении скрипта. Освоение admiral-x требует вдумчивого подхода и исследования итогов реализации операторов.

No Comments
Leave a Comment

new online casino
casino online
Padişahbet Giriş
top casino online
Betnano Giriş
Padişahbet Giriş
Padişahbet
online curacao casino
Padişahbet Güncel Giriş
Crypto Casino